Well, if you were wondering if the league missed Tom Brady last year, and you missed the report after "THE" injury that his absence from the league had an $1.2 Billion (negative) affect on Fantasy Football last year. Look no further than this report from the meetings this weekend:

ProFootballTalk.com - MORE RULE CHANGES TO PROTECT PLAYERS?

"A potential rule change would make it illegal for defensive players on their knees to lunge at quarterbacks.

The specific play Mortensen referenced was Bernard Pollard’s hit on Tom Brady last season. Under the new rule, a similar play would draw a penalty and possibly a fine from the league."
